Piri-Piri Marinade

Introduction

Piri-piri chicken is such a great marinade to use on most meats, however Chicken is my favourite! The following list of ingredients makes enough marinade to use on a kilo of chicken, (I almost always use chicken thighs), a whole chicken you also work well! This recipe is well worth trying! The ingredients don't cost the earth, the marinade takes a few minutes to make and the taste of the chicken after marinating for 24 hours is phenomenal! IngredientsIngredients

4 – 5 Fresh hot chilli peppers.
Juice of 2 lemons (a lime could be used too).
4 tablespoons of oil (vegetable or olive oil is fine).
1 tablespoon of cayenne pepper.
3 cloves of fresh garlic.
1 tablespoon of paprika.
1 teaspoon of salt.
1 teaspoon of oregano.

Method

Chuck everything into a blender and blitz, if you want some whole chilli rings in the mix just chop some up before blending and keep them aside. If the mixture doesn’t look like it’s made enough just chuck in some more oil to top it up.

How to use

Transfer the marinade into a glass bowl and add the chicken, mix the chicken in thoroughly and even better still use a knife to carefully pierce the skin and meat and push the marinade into all the nooks and crannies!

Seal the bowl air tight with cellophane and refrigerate for 24 hours, the time spent in the fridge can be less but I try and aim for a day.

How to cook

The absolute best way to cook this kind of chicken is on a charcoal BBQ! But if the weathers bad or don't have the energy just stick it in the grill (George forman grills are a great alternative too). The most important thing when cooking chicken is to make sure it’s fully cooked at the thickest parts.
